Selecting one of the best wines for a winery tasting event is an exhilarating but difficult task. Making Certain that your choice resonates with totally different palates can elevate an ordinary gathering into an unforgettable experience. Guests come to savor quality wines, learn about them, and indulge of their flavors. Due To This Fact, the first step is to define the theme of the event.


Themes can affect not solely the forms of wines chosen but additionally how these wines are introduced. Taste High-Quality Wines from Sonoma Valley. A regional theme could focus on wines from a specific space, such as California's Napa Valley or Italy’s Tuscany. Alternatively, a varietal theme might emphasize particular grape types, such as Pinot Noir or Chardonnay. As Quickly As a theme is established, choosing wines that align with it turns into extra easy.


Subsequent, consider the range of wines. It is crucial to include a various selection that showcases different varietals, areas, and styles. This variety allows attendees to discover new favorites and appreciate the intricacies of winemaking. Including sparkling wines, white wines, rosés, red wines, and dessert wines can cater to varied preferences and enhance the tasting experience.


The quality of the wine is instrumental in making the event memorable. Sourcing wines from respected producers or acclaimed vineyards is essential. This ensures that guests are tasting wines crafted with care and expertise. It Is beneficial to pattern the wines upfront to gauge the flavor profiles and the way they pair with the food offerings.

Pairing food with wine is another crucial side of crafting a profitable tasting event. The proper food can elevate the tasting experience, enhancing the flavors of the wines. Light appetizers may be paired with white wines, whereas hearty dishes may go well with red wines higher. Think About providing a combination of cheeses, charcuterie, fruits, and pastries to accompany the choice of wines.


Partaking storytelling about each wine can create an immersive experience. Sharing the background of the vineyards, the winemaking processes, and the inspiration behind the selections provides a private contact. Visitors respect hearing in regards to the nuances of each wine, offering context and deepening their appreciation for what they are tasting.


Contemplate the logistics of the event as properly. Correct serving temperatures, glassware, and tasting order can considerably have an result on guests' experiences. Whites should be chilled while reds are ideally served at room temperature. The order of tasting can follow a progression, beginning with light wines and shifting towards heavier ones, which may prevent lighter flavors from being overshadowed.


Incorporating interactive elements, similar to guided tastings or wine blending periods, can also improve the event. This type of participation invites friends to connect with the wines on a deeper degree. Allowing friends to precise their preferences helps create a more participating ambiance and fosters discussions about their experiences.

How many various wines ought to I embody in the tasting?undefinedA good variety of wines to characteristic in a tasting event is 5 to 7. This allows visitors to get pleasure from a range of flavors without changing into overwhelmed. Too many choices can lead to palate fatigue, detracting from the experience.


What should I think about when pairing wines with food for the event?undefinedWhen pairing wines with food, give consideration to complementary flavors. For example, lighter wines pair properly with seafood and salads, whereas full-bodied reds work fantastically with hearty dishes such as steak. Additionally, think about having a quantity of neutral or versatile options to accommodate varied dishes.

How should the wines be served in the course of the tasting?undefinedWines should be served at their optimum temperatures; whites chilled, reds slightly beneath room temperature. Use applicable glassware for each wine style, pouring small quantities to allow friends to savor and evaluate the wines. Always present proper rinsing water between totally different wine tastings.
